Inspection History
Apr 6, 2026
Routine
1 minor violation.
View 1 violation
No certified food protection manager
Inspector notes: Observed no certified food protection manager on the premises at time of inspection. A Certified Food Protection Manager (CFPM) is required to be on the premises during all hours of operation
2-102.12(A)
95
Nov 24, 2025
Routine
1 critical violation. 1 major violation. 2 corrected on site.
View 2 violations
Hands not washed when required (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ed cook with gloved hand handle raw chicken and then proceed to place on a pair of clean gloves to work with ready to eat food without first washing hands. Inspector instructed employee to properly wash hands before gloving when changing tasks while working with food
2-301.14
Sanitizer test kit not available (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Sanitizer strips not available for testing chlorine sanitizer in the low temperature dishwasher. Manager obtained strips during inspection
4-302.14
